What you’ll do As Vice President, Verification & Validation, you will lead the transformation from document-centric V&V to an AI-enabled, model-based continuous validation ecosystem leveraging digital twins, fleet data, and an end-to-end digital thread. You will define and drive the enterprise strategy for verification and validation across vehicle systems, ensuring safety, compliance, robustness, and speed of execution across the full product lifecycle. This strategic leadership role requires deep expertise in automotive engineering, MBSE, SysML v2, requirements traceability end-to-end, AI-enabled validation methods, and data-driven decision-making, combined with exceptional leadership and cross-functional collaboration skills.   Become part of an iconic brand that is set to revolutionize the electric pick-up truck & rugged SUV marketplace by achieving the following: Develop and execute a forward-looking verification and validation strategy that drives the shift from document-centric processes to AI-enabled, model-based continuous validation.   Build and lead a high-performing V&V organization across systems, software, hardware, and vehicle integration, fostering innovation, technical excellence, and operational rigor in support of software-defined vehicle (SDV) development.   Establish and scale validation frameworks leveraging digital twins, simulation, virtual verification, HiL/SiL/MiL, CI/CD validation pipelines, automated regression testing, and fleet data analytics to enable earlier defect detection and continuous learning.   Partner closely with systems engineering, software, hardware, product, manufacturing, and quality teams to define validation requirements and ensure end-to-end requirements traceability through a robust digital thread across the development lifecycle.   Drive adoption of MBSE, SysML v2, digital thread practices, requirements traceability (e2e), test automation, scenario-based validation, and AI-assisted test generation to improve validation coverage, speed, and quality.   Leverage connected vehicle and field performance data to enable closed-loop validation, AI-based coverage analysis, machine learning for defect prediction, and data-driven prioritization of validation activities.   Champion the use of GenAI for requirements review and test review, increasing consistency, completeness, and effici
